Ingredients
-
cooking spray
-
3 cups shredded cooked chicken
-
¾ cup crumbled blue cheese
-
⅓ (8 ounce) package cream cheese
-
¼ cup hot sauce, or more as needed
-
1 (10 ounce) container refrigerated thin crust pizza dough (such as Pillsbury®)
Directions
-
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Spray a baking sheet with cooking spray.
-
Mix chicken, blue cheese, cream cheese, and hot sauce together in a bowl.
-
Unroll pizza dough onto the baking sheet and spread chicken mixture in a line down the center of the dough. Wrap dough around chicken mixture, tucking and pinching the seams together.
-
Bake in the preheated oven until crust is golden brown, 15 to 20 minutes. Let stromboli cool for a few minutes before slicing.
Cook's Note:
Try different kinds of Buffalo wing sauces instead of hot sauce.
